    Soldiers, prisoners and converts between permeable borders in the Mare Nostrum (16th-18th centuries)

    The COST Action “Islamic Legacy: Narratives East, West, South, North of the Mediterranean (1350-1750)” [CA 18129] is launching a call for a conference “Soldiers, prisoners and converts between permeable borders in the Mare Nostrum (16th-18th centuries)”. The event that we are disseminating is being organised within this project, which as the purpose to provide a transnational and interdisciplinary approach capable of overcoming the segmentation that currently characterizes the study of relations between Christianity and Islam in late medieval and early modern Europe and the Mediterranean. We aim to create a network that will help to provide a comprehensive understanding of past relations between Christianity and Islam in the European context through the addressing of three main research problems: otherness, migration and borders.

    School and minorities in Germanic countries (18th-21st centuries)

    Cette journée d’étude internationale s’interrogera sur la place des minorités culturelles, ethniques ou religieuses dans l’espace scolaire des pays germaniques, du XVIIIe siècle à aujourd’hui. Bi- ou multiculturalisme, affirmation ou gommage des différences, parcours d’intégration et de réussite sociale ou au contraire repli identitaire, toutes ces questions passent par l’institution scolaire, quelle que soit sa tutelle. La manifestation n’entend certes pas épuiser une problématique très complexe, car située au carrefour de l’institutionnel, du culturel, des traditions historiques, du politique, du religieux et du social. Mais elle se propose de faire mieux connaître les enjeux tels qu’ils se présentent dans l’aire culturelle et linguistique germanique, de l’émancipation des juifs allemands dans la Prusse des Lumières à l’intégration des minorités musulmanes dans l’Allemagne actuelle, en passant par la problématique huguenote ou sorabe, et avec une incursion dans le système scolaire français face à la minorité linguistique alsacienne. Dans le sens de ce rapprochement, la journée se clôturera par une table ronde réunissant différents acteurs du monde éducatif autour du défi de la prise en compte des minorités dans les systèmes scolaires français et allemands d’hier, d’aujourd’hui et de demain.

    Nature(s): Designing, Experiencing, Representing the natural environment (18th to 21st centuries)

    The international conference "Nature(s)" which will be held on June 6-8th, 2013 and will coincide with other cultural and scientific events in Nantes as a "European Green Capital", will question what is really at stake when human beings consciously deal with nature and natural spaces, especially in an urban context. Over the centuries, how have writers, artists, painters or landscape planners been grappling with nature in a rapidly growing urban world, and how did they question the way in which human beings lived but also dreamt their future?
